Output e39a176750b59a90c423026358b8409ae04867cfff26eae7c20a4cf06fc0bbda:21

value
1426896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375f5aa4ee2494f2c8681a44d0d715083f459 OP_EQUAL
address
3BMEXdvkgEWR16ctnYXvfqKuEhyDgpXm8i
transaction
e39a176750b59a90c423026358b8409ae04867cfff26eae7c20a4cf06fc0bbda
spent
false

1 Sat Range